ENGLISH LANGUAGE: 9TH GRADE STUDY GUIDE
Textbooks: English as a Second Language, (Units 1 – 5) Grammar Materials
Notebooks, (All classnotes, discussions, activities and assignments)
Exam
Reading exercise 1. Students will read a short text and answer a series of questions testing
skim/gist-reading skills. Candidates write short (single word/phrase) answers.
Reading exercise 2. Students will read a text and answer a series of questions testing more
detailed comprehension.
Summary writing. Students will write a summary about an aspect or aspects of the passage.
Writing prompt. Students will write approximately 100–150 words of continuous prose, in
response to a short stimulus (which may take the form of pictures) and/or short prompts printed on the paper. The question includes information on the purpose, format and audience.
